    Rebounding from the big spot is a big part of your team defense. He's one of the worst rebounding bigs the Rockets have had in recent years so I can't really see how anyone can say with a straight face that he's not a weakness on defense.

    THAT BEING SAID - D-Mo (alot like Patrick Patterson) is very good at rotations, and help side defense. Something that alot of Rockets since the departure of the Battier years Rockets, have been very undisciplined at.

    D-Mo seems to fit best next to another big who is a plus rebounder, but someone that doesn't take up his space in the paint on offense. I look at like a Taj Gibson type of player fitting in well with him on the frontline. Having good rebounding guards and wings like Pat Beverley with him too would help as well.

    Point being... he is a very flawed player up to this point in his career on the defensive end, but I'm still a fan, and looking forward to him coming back on the squad. I do think he can help.
